subject: subforms revisited

Here's the problem: My main form has a field LCode that is linked to
the subform.  It's the key field so duplicate entries generate an 
error.  If I tab off the LCode field the next control is the subform 
control, named SubPlace.  The problem occurs when I use an existing
LCode and tab to the subform.  I get the error, which is Ok, but then
the subform gets focus and displays its records linked to the LCode
that I can not use.  I'd much rather have the LCode keep focus and
set the value to Null.  The Form_Error seems to disable any code 
attached to LCode's afterupdate. 
How do I "disable" the subform and stay on the LCode until a valid
LCode is entered?
